What is a Credit Card Payoff Calculator?
A Credit Card Payoff Calculator is an online financial tool that helps you estimate how long it will take to pay off your credit card balance based on your current balance, annual interest rate (APR), and monthly payment amount. It also calculates the total amount you will pay and the total interest incurred.
This tool eliminates guesswork and allows you to make informed choices to minimize interest payments, reduce debt faster, and improve your financial health.

Example Calculation
Let’s take an example to understand how the calculator works:
- Current Balance: $5,000
- APR: 18%
- Monthly Payment: $200
Step 1: Convert APR to monthly interest rate:
Monthly Rate = APR / 12 = 18 / 12 = 1.5% per month
Step 2: Estimate months to payoff: Using the calculator, it calculates interest each month and applies your payment toward interest first, then principal.

Tips for Effective Use
- Make Higher Payments: Paying more than the minimum can save you months of interest.
- Check APR Accuracy: Ensure you enter the correct APR, as even small differences can affect results significantly.
- Track Multiple Cards Separately: Calculate each card separately to plan payoff strategies.
- Use for Planning: Input different monthly payment scenarios to see how much time and interest you can save.
- Review Regularly: Update calculations as balances and payments change.
